credits

released 08 February 2011
All songs written and performed by Cara Kinnally and Greg Simpson

Except strings on “Spinning My Wheels” written and performed by:
Amanda Nelson - cello, Robin Weseloh Sackschewsky - violin
and Nathan Sackschewsky - viola
Drum machine programming on “Grown Up Problems” by Jeffrey Brooks

And “One Great City!” written by The Weakerthans, lyrics by John K. Samson

Recorded November 27th and 28th at Apocalypse Cow in Montgomery, IL
by Theresa Brooks and Jeffrey Brooks, mixed by Jeffrey Brooks
and at the OV Studio Loft December 2010-January 2011
by Greg Simpson, mixed by Greg Simpson
Produced by Greg Simpson
Mastered by Jeffrey Brooks at Apocalypse Cow [ www.callthecow.com ]

Artwork by Laura Berger [ www.laura-berger.blogspot.com ]
Instrument rental thanks to Matt Benson

Photo by Anneke Riley
